I find that blogging with my own name, I tend to blog a lot about myself. It’s the same with John Chow when he also blogs a lot about himself. So, I have decided to keep my name identity as who I really am. And I am really feel that blog should have a certain branding by itself.

It could be your name, if you want it that way.

It could be a verb or a noun found in the dictionary.

It could be a nice little unique name to work with.

Whatever you are choosing, it works. I am very sure! It’s just about what you wish to work on.

Content is the one that keeps the person coming back. It wouldn’t be nice for a person to see what I am blogging which doesn’t interest him. It’s especially when you are into online publishing business – blogging.
